11 Ways to Get Rid of Pop‐Ups
Introduction:
Pop-up ads can be quite irritating and distracting, often impacting your online browsing experience. From interrupting your focus to exposing you to potential security threats, pop-up ads introduce a range of issues web users face daily. To combat this disturbance, we’ve compiled a list of 11 ways to help you easily get rid of pop-ups.
1. Enable the built-in pop-up blocker:
Most modern web browsers, such as Google Chrome, Mozilla Firefox, or Microsoft Edge, have built-in pop-up blockers to help limit the number of pop-ups you encounter. To enable this feature, head over to your browser’s settings and activate the pop-up blocker.
2. Adjust the browser’s privacy settings:
Optimizing your browser’s privacy settings will not only help prevent many pop-ups but also protect your personal information. Adjust the settings accordingly by limiting the data that websites can collect and use for their own benefits.
3. Install ad-blocking extensions:
There are several ad-blocking extensions available that effectively block most kinds of online advertisements, including pop-ups. Adblock Plus, Poper Blocker, and StopAd are popular ad-blocking plugins available for various browsers.
4. Use an alternate web browser:
Some web browsers are designed specifically for enhanced privacy and improved ad-blocking features. Browsers such as Brave or Firefox Focus place a considerable emphasis on protecting users from unwanted ads and pop-ups.
5. Keep software up-to-date:
Regularly updating your browser and computer software will ensure that you have the latest security patches and fixes required to minimize exposure to intrusive ads.
6. Disable JavaScript temporarily:
Since many pop-ups leverage JavaScript code to appear on the webpage, disabling it in your browser could potentially eliminate them. Keep in mind that disabling JavaScript may impact the overall functionality of some websites.
7. Visit ad-free or reputable websites:
Reduce your exposure to advertisements by visiting only ad-free or reputable websites that prioritize user experience over ad revenue.
8. Adjust your computer’s security settings:
Similar to browser settings, your computer’s security settings may help control the appearance of pop-up ads. Ensure that you have the latest antivirus software installed and configured correctly.
9. Use a virtual private network (VPN):
A VPN can prevent pop-ups by encrypting your internet traffic and routing it through a secure server. Additionally, using a VPN with built-in ad-blocking features further enhances your browsing experience.
10. Clear browser data and cache:
Regularly clearing your browser’s data, including cookies and cache, can help prevent pop-up ads from persistently displaying on websites.
11. Identify and uninstall adware/malware:
Pop-ups can also be caused by malicious software infecting your computer. Use a reliable antivirus program to locate and eliminate any suspicious programs or files.
